What Are Surety Contract Bonds?
Surety Contract bonds are a kind of financial warranty that gives assurance to task owners that service providers will meet their contractual responsibilities. These bonds work as a form of defense for the task owner by making sure that the service provider will certainly complete the project as set, or make up for any type of economic loss incurred.
When a specialist acquires a surety bond, they're basically participating in a lawfully binding arrangement with a surety business. This agreement mentions that the professional will meet their responsibilities and satisfy all contractual needs. If the specialist stops working to do so, the surety business will action in and offer the necessary funds to finish the job or compensate the task proprietor for any kind of damages.
In this way, Surety Contract bonds offer comfort to task owners and mitigate the dangers related to hiring contractors.
Recognizing the Duty of Surety Bonding Companies
Currently allow's discover the crucial function that surety bonding companies play on the planet of Surety Contract bonds.
Surety bonding business act as a 3rd party that assures the Performance and satisfaction of legal responsibilities. They provide a financial assurance to the obligee, commonly the job proprietor, that the principal, generally the specialist, will finish the project according to the terms of the Contract.
On the occasion that the principal fails to meet their responsibilities, the surety bonding business action in to make certain that the task is finished or that the obligee is compensated for any kind of monetary losses.

The Conveniences and Relevance of Surety Contract Bonds
Understanding the advantages and relevance of Surety Contract bonds is vital for all celebrations associated with a construction project.
Surety Contract bonds provide economic defense and peace of mind for job proprietors, professionals, and subcontractors. For job owners, these bonds guarantee that the professional will accomplish their obligations and finish the job as set. This secures the proprietor from financial loss in case of specialist default or non-performance.
Service providers take advantage of Surety Contract bonds too, as they give integrity and demonstrate their capacity to meet contractual responsibilities. Subcontractors likewise benefit, as they're ensured of settlement for their job, even if the professional falls short to pay them.
